摘要
Because of hostile service environment and complicated working loads, aero-engine components are apt to high-cycle fatigue fracture, which seriously affects security and reliability of aero-engine. Laser shock peening, LSP, is a novel surface plastic-strengthening technology. High-cycle fatigue performance can be improved effectively under the action of compressive residual stress and microstructural modification. LSP has been widely applied in the batch production and maintenance of aero-engine components. Research status, application situation and problems to be resolved of laser shock peening on fan/compressor blade, turbine blade, turbine disk, cartridge receiver, hydraulic actuator, pipe, gear and so on were discussed deeply. The development tendency of laser shock peening research on aero-engine components in recent years was analyzed and concluded. The future work on equipment, technique, mechanism and application of laser shock peening on aero-engine components was taken an outlook. In future, hope that the large-scale industrial application of laser shock peening on aero-engine components could be realized under the synergistic action of the whole industry and the whole technology chain. © 2021 Journal of Mechanical Engineering.
